VITERBO — 28 MILES

Viterbo is another that dates back to Etruscan times, and had some prominence in medieval times. In fact, it was one of the more important cities in Europe around the 12th – 13th centuries. Papal elections were held in the Palazzo dei Papi and popes would seek refuge in Viterbo when driven out of Rome. It was also the scene of battles between Rome’s invaders and papal armies. Nowadays, its main claim to fame is that it’s the home of Italy’s gold reserves.

​If you’d like to wonder around Viterbo, head for the old city center, in the Saint Pellegrino district, near Palazzo dei Papi. It’s a good section of town to take in the medieval atmosphere. Some of the better streets for strolling in this area are Via San Lorenzo and Via del Cimiter
